This company was founded in 2009 and is headquartered in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il.

Vinci Compass Investments Ltd. (VINP) offers a portfolio of strategies and solutions for alternative investments: Private Markets, Liquid Strategies, Investment Products and Solutions, and Financial Advisory.

Vinci Compass’s single share price dropped $0.425 or over 4.29% in the past year, from $9.915 to $9.49 per Thursday’s opening market report.

Six analysts cover the stock. The median of their one year price projections indicates a $5.01 annual price gain. However, the average of VINP’s past three year price progression from  $7.70 to $9.49 shows an average annual gain of about $0.60. I’ll average the two annual gain estimates of $5.01 and $0.60 to reach $2.81 as a prediction for the coming year’s returns, which must include annual dividends, too.

VINP Dividends

Vinci Compass has paid variable Quarterly dividends since September 2021. The most recent Q dividend of $0.17 was paid September 9th, 2026 (to shareholders of record August 25th), yielding $0.68 or 7.24% annually (per Thursday’s opening market report)

VINP Returns

Putting it all together, as of September 10th, a possible Vinci Compass gross gain of $3.49 was projected. 

To get there, our $2.81 average per-share annual gain was added to the $0.68 presumed forward-looking annual dividend to make that $3.49 gross gain. 

A little over $1000 invested in VINP at Thursday’s $9.49 opening share price would buy 105.37 shares, which multiply the hypothetical $3.49 gross gain to $367.76 for the coming year, or 36.77%.

My dividend dogcatcher rule is to only buy initial shares of a dividend stock that pay an annual dividend (from $1000 invested) that is greater than the cost of one share.

Vinci Compass’s projected annual dividend from $1K invested is $72.40, and that annual dividend proves to be over 7.6 times more than its recent $9.49 single-share price.
